Transaction 34bfd7cdf2e41e1566273679355f17d4b47accc464a12d2ace14737eb7d98bd9
1 Input
2 Outputs
- 34bfd7cdf2e41e1566273679355f17d4b47accc464a12d2ace14737eb7d98bd9:0
- 34bfd7cdf2e41e1566273679355f17d4b47accc464a12d2ace14737eb7d98bd9:1
value 31031874
address 16zbtQ3aRvHAV28DpyqZ4QTP3EToYWMFTr
value 453336502
address 1KAw7XnsL82aUXqm92yvGSWHipaMbyJBU3